These celestial leaping dolphins were pure joy to create! After making the repeating pattern, I came up with a couple different colorways and coordinating wave patterns to complete this mini collection.
I also adapted one of my dolphin drawings from this piece into a wall hanging, laser cut from wood. I used thinned acrylic paints to mimic a stained or watercolor look so the beautiful wood grain shows through. I used specialized glitter paint to make the sun, moon, and stars sparkle and catch the light. Once fully dry, the finishing touch was several thick coats of super shiny gloss varnish to give it a resin-like finish.
